Researchers at the University of Würzburg are developing a new therapy for KEAP1-mutated lung cancer using a sulfite inhibitor to block tumor cell growth. The team has identified a first-of-its-kind compound, SulfExstatin-1, which accumulates toxic sulfite in cancer cells, initiating their death.

Researchers at Keck Medicine of USC found that high doses of corticosteroids can limit the effectiveness of immunotherapies in treating non-small cell lung cancer. Corticosteroids, commonly prescribed for symptom management, were shown to stop T-cells from maturing, reducing their ability to attack cancer cells.
A whole-genome sequencing study found fine-particulate air pollution to cause more cancer-related changes than secondhand smoke. Researchers analyzed lung tumors from 871 never-smoker patients across 28 geographic locations worldwide and linked air pollution exposure to increased genomic changes.
A new study reveals that air pollution contributes to the development of lung cancer in people with no or hardly any history of smoking. The study found a strong association between air pollution and genetic mutations in lung tumors, particularly driver mutations that promote cancer development.

A study of 95 patients found that wrapping autologous tissue materials around anastomoses after airway reconstruction significantly reduced short-term postoperative complications. This technique may offer a positive effect on the prognosis of patients undergoing complex tracheobronchial resection and reconstruction.
A retrospective study found ESL to be a safe and viable alternative to pneumonectomy for selected patients with centrally located NSCLC. ESL offered better event-free survival compared to pneumonectomy.
A study of 203 patients shows that electromagnetic navigation bronchoscopy (ENBDM) is a safer and faster alternative to CT-guided localization for preoperative treatment of multiple pulmonary nodules in the same lung. ENBDM achieved comparable accuracy with lower complication rates, making it an optimal strategy.

Researchers at Nagoya University have created CAR-T cells that recognize and target the Eva1 protein on cancer cells, effectively eliminating tumors in lab mice. The treatment is designed to be safer by ignoring healthy cells with low amounts of Eva1.
Researchers found that cigarette smoke and reduced DNA repair capacity combine to increase cancer risk, with normal lung cells showing extensive damage after smoke exposure. The study's findings support a 'double hit' model, highlighting the critical role of XPC protein in preventing DNA damage.
A revolutionary AI model has been developed to diagnose lung cancer without relying on costly GPU servers or massive datasets. The ultra-lightweight model achieved a discrimination performance corresponding to an AUC value of 0.92, outperforming state-of-the-art large-scale AI systems.

A deep learning model called Sybil can predict future lung cancer risk from a single low-dose chest CT scan. The model demonstrated good performance in predicting cancer diagnosis at both one and six years, including in never-smokers.
A nationwide cohort study found that immune checkpoint inhibitors significantly increase the risk of myocarditis in NSCLC patients, with a 7.4-fold increase in risk compared to non-users. Cardiac monitoring for at least six months following ICI initiation is recommended.

Researchers investigated pleurodesis treatment for lung cancer patients with interstitial lung disease, finding an efficacy rate of about 70% with talc and minocycline. However, cases with partially expanded lungs or recent systemic prednisolone treatment increased the risk of acute respiratory distress syndrome.
Researchers found that using current lung cancer screening criteria may overlook at-risk populations, such as older adults and non-English speakers. Incorporating additional factors could enhance diagnostic screening effectiveness in Emergency Department patients.
The study demonstrated the diagnostic utility of endobronchial ultrasound elastography for detecting benign and malignant lymph nodes. The combined index of elastography grading score and short diameter yielded an area under the receiver operating characteristic curve of 0.702, indicating moderate accuracy.

A Phase Ia/Ib trial found that zongertinib demonstrated clinical benefits for patients with advanced HER2-mutant non-small cell lung cancer, particularly those with specific HER2 mutations. The treatment showed a 71% objective response rate and manageable side effects.
A phase I clinical trial found that zoldonrasib elicited objective responses and disease control in patients with KRAS G12D-mutated NSCLC. The study demonstrated the efficacy and tolerability of the oral agent, which selectively targets the active conformation of KRAS.
A recent study found that cigarette smoking continues to decline across the US, mainly driven by young adults. The states with historically high smoking rates have seen the most significant declines in smoking prevalence.
Researchers found that blood cells carrying age-related mutations can infiltrate tumours, leading to worse cancer outcomes. The presence of these mutations was associated with shorter survival rates in patients with lung and other aggressive cancers.
Liquid biopsy analyzes circulating tumor components in body fluids to detect cancer at early stages, offering a safer and more dynamic alternative to traditional tissue biopsies. This non-invasive approach has shown promise in detecting various types of cancer, including lung, breast, colorectal, prostate, and gastric cancers.

A new study suggests that CT scans could account for 5% of all cancer cases each year, primarily due to radiation exposure. The largest risk is among infants, followed by children and adolescents. To mitigate this risk, reducing the number of scans and doses per scan can help save lives.

A study by the University of Barcelona reveals that dynamic BH3 profiling can predict the effectiveness of ALK inhibitors in treating non-small cell lung cancer. The technique helps select the best drug for each patient, overcoming tumour adaptations to inhibitors.
Researchers at KAIST discovered that DDX54 is the master regulator hindering immunotherapy's effectiveness in lung cancer. Supressing DDX54 enhances immune cell infiltration into tumors and improves immunotherapy efficacy.
